DEVELOPMENT OF VEHICULAR ADHOC NETWORK (VANET) USING NS2 SIMULATION
Details
In this book, we explained about Vehiclualr Adhoc Network routing Protocols, which are used for automated vehicle to vehicle communication. Vehicle-to-vehicle (V2V) communication's ability to wirelessly exchange information about the speed and position of surrounding vehicles shows great promise in helping to avoid crashes, ease traffic congestion, and improve the environment. But the greatest benefits can only be achieved when all vehicles can communicate with each other. NS2 simulator and Vanet Mobisim tools are also explained clearly.
